Linux下的精准过滤命令秘籍(linux过滤命令)
2023-06-13 09:13:29 时间
Linux作为一个多用户多任务,它对日常操作具有很高的方便性,精准过滤命令是每一个追求效率的用户来说必不可少的技能之一,本文将介绍Linux下的精准过滤命令秘籍。
1、grep
grep 命令是Linux下常用的搜索文本或字符行的利器,它常用来搜索指定文本或字符行,并将找到的结果输出出来,例如查找当前目录下的文件中包含abc的行:
`shell
grep abc *
2、fzf
fzf 是一款基于GNU/Linux 的终端文本查找和编辑工具,fzf可以让您快速模糊搜索字符串,它很方便并且非常灵活。fzf语法类似grep,它可以让您查找和编辑文件中的字符串,例如搜索当前目录下的文件:
```shellfzf -d
3、sed
sed 是 stream editor 的缩写,它是一款强大的文本过滤和编辑器,它可以实现文本替换,操作文本行,它 lets 您将大量的文本进行编辑。它常被用来用来在文件中按指定的模式替换文本,例如替换文件中的字符串:
`shell
sed -i s/old_word/new_word/g filename
4、awk
awk 是一款用于把文件分割为数据列,以及查找和处理文本文件中的字符串或字段的编程语言,该语言通过特定格式操作文本文件,它可以让您从文本文件中查找指定字符,例如在文本文件中搜索加载的字符串:
```shellawk "/STRING/" filename
以上是Linux下的精准过滤命令秘籍,其中grep、fzf、sed 以及awk是最重要的几个命令,可以帮助我们充分发挥Linux的功能优势。掌握这几个命令的运用,可以让您在Linux系统中更有效率地工作。
我想要获取技术服务或软件
服务范围:MySQL、ORACLE、SQLSERVER、MongoDB、PostgreSQL 、程序问题
服务方式:远程服务、电话支持、现场服务,沟通指定方式服务
技术标签:数据恢复、安装配置、数据迁移、集群容灾、异常处理、其它问题
本站部分文章参考或来源于网络,如有侵权请联系站长。
数据库远程运维 Linux下的精准过滤命令秘籍(linux过滤命令)
相关文章
- Linux磁盘分区:学会使用fdisk 命令(linux磁盘分区命令)
- 查询Linux版本:如何快捷完成(查询linux版本)
- Linux下实现输出技术的优化(linux输出内容)
- 行操作Linux下的命令行操作简介(linux–命令)
- Linux制作安装镜像:一步一步指南(linux制作安装镜像)
- 轻松学习Linux脚本之CP命令(linux脚本cp)
- Linux安装Sudo:让您拥有更多权限(linux安装sudo)
- 和新特性Linux分支及其新特性探究(linux的分支)
- Linux查看本机IP地址的实现方法(linux查看本机地址)
- Linux下的回车命令示范(linux回车命令)
- Linux的字符界面:为操作系统带来更多可能(linux的字符界面)
- Linux的发展之路:分支丰富多样(linux的分支)
- 系统释放Linux之灵:了解分支系统(linux的分支)
- 如何在 Linux 系统中加载光驱?(linux加载光驱)
- 探索Linux下命令搜索神器(linux提示命令找不到)
- Linux访问共享文件: 教程与实践(linux访问共享文件)
- 「Linux 学习」删除空目录:快速整理文件夹(linux删除空目录命令)
- Linux命令快速轻松修改文件名(linux命令修改文件名)
- Linux命令大全:掌握这些常用命令,轻松玩转Linux!(linux常用命令全称)
- 如何在Linux中查看之前输入过的命令?(linux查看之前的命令)